How We Remove Water from Refrigerator Leaks
Our team follows a strict process to ensure that your home is restored to its original condition. We use specialized equipment to detect moisture levels and map out the affected area. Our technicians then use a combination of pumps and vacuums to remove standing water and extract water from walls and floors. We also use specialized drying equipment to speed up the evaporation process and prevent further damage.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We begin by assessing the extent of the damage and developing a customized plan to restore your property. Our technicians use specialized equipment to detect moisture levels and map out the affected area. This helps us to identify the source of the leak and develop a plan to contain and remove the water.
Step 2: Water Removal and Extraction
Our technicians use pumps and vacuums to remove standing water and extract water from walls and floors. We also use specialized drying equipment to speed up the evaporation process and prevent further dam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We use specialized equipment to speed up the evaporation process and prevent further damage. Our technicians also use d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ture from the air and prevent mold growth.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Our technicians use specialized cleaning solutions to remove dirt, grime, and bacteria from affected surfaces. We also use sanitizing equipment to kill any remaining bacteria and prevent future growth.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Testing
We conduct a final inspection to ensure that your home is dry and free from any remaining moisture. Our technicians also test for any signs of mold or bacteria to ensure that your home is safe and healthy.

Warning Signs You Need Refrigerator Water Line Leak Removal
Catching the signs of a refrigerator water line leak early can save you money and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ong musty odors in your home can be a sign of a refrigerator water line leak. If you notice a persistent smell that won’t go away, it’s time to call our team for help.
Water Stains on Ceilings and Walls
Water stains on your ceilings and walls can be a sign of a refrigerator water line leak. If you notice any discoloration or water damage, it’s essential to address the issue quickly.
Water Pooling Under Appliances
Water pooling under your appliances can be a sign of a refrigerator water line leak. If you notice any water accumulation, it’s crucial to address the issue before it becomes a bigger problem.
Increased Water Bills
An increase in your water bills can be a sign of a refrigerator water line leak. If you notice a sudden spike in your water usage, it’s time to investigate the cause.
Water Damage to Surrounding Areas
Water damage to surrounding areas can be a sign of a refrigerator water line leak. If you notice any water damage to your cabinets, floors, or walls, it’s essential to address the issue quickly.
Visible Water Leaks
Visible water leaks from your refrigerator water line can be a sign of a serious issue. If you notice any water leaks, it’s crucial to address the issue before it becomes a bigger problem.
